实时控制需求下的工作站配置工控机VS PLC硬件资源比较

在工业自动化系统中,工控机和PLC(Programmable Logic Controller)是两种常见的控制设备,它们各自具有不同的特点和应用场景。为了满足不同级别的实时控制需求,选择合适的工作站配置至关重要。本文将从工控机和PLC硬件资源对比的角度出发,为读者提供一份详细的参考。

工控机与PLC区别概述

在工业自动化领域,工控机通常指的是计算能力更强、软件功能更加丰富的一类电脑,而PLC则是一种专为实施逻辑控制而设计的小型微处理器。它们之间最显著的区别在于计算能力、存储容量、通信协议以及成本等方面。

硬件资源对比

处理器性能

处理速度:由于其设计初衷是快速响应现场数据变化,PLC通常拥有更快的处理速度。这使得它能够及时响应传感器输入,并迅速执行相应动作。

多任务处理能力:虽然现代PLC也能支持一定程度的事务并行,但相对于高性能服务器或工业PC,其多任务处理能力仍然有限。而且,由于其固有编程语言较为简单,对复杂算法支持不足,因此不宜用于需要大量浮点运算或复杂数学模型应用的情境中。

存储容量

RAM内存:对于需要频繁访问大量数据或者进行复杂计算的情况下,更多RAM内存可以极大地提高操作效率。在此方面,工业PC往往具备更大的内存空间,从而优化程序运行效率。

ROM/Flash存储:尽管最新一代PLCs可能配备了较大的Flash存储来提升程序库大小,但是总体上来说,与现代工业PC相比,它们所能支撑的大规模程序还是有限制。此外,由于实际使用场景限制,一些项目可能并不要求用户升级或修改现有代码,因此这种限制并不总是成为瓶颈因素。

输入输出接口数量与类型

PLc主要通过模拟输入/输出端口直接连接传感器与执行元件,如电磁阀或继电器,这些端口数量受限于芯片本身设计。不过,有一些高级型号会集成额外的一些数字I/O端口以扩展功能范围。

工业PC则通过PCIe卡插槽,可以轻松扩展各种接口如串行端口、USB、高速网络接入等,以适应各种通信需求,同时还可安装特殊用途板卡,如视频捕获卡、GPS模块等,以增强系统功能性。

通信协议差异分析

在实现远程监视和管理,以及不同设备间信息交换时,不同类型的通信协议被广泛采用。例如:

MODBUS RTU/TCP/IP 是一种非常流行且普遍使用于SCADA系统中的通讯标准,它允许从一个中心位置监测和管理数百个远程终端。但是,由于MODBUS基础设施构建起来相对困难,而且没有很好的安全措施,所以随着时间推移,大多数新的应用都开始转向其他技术。

PROFINET是一个基于TCP/IP协议栈构建的人员物资整合解决方案(PROFibus)。它支持高速网络通讯,并且提供了良好的安全性保证,使得其越来越受到企业IT部门青睐。

EtherNet/IP 是另一种基于TCP/IP标准的一个开放式网络通讯解决方案,是由ODVA组织开发出来用于Industrial Automation领域的一个生态系统。它结合了EtherNet物理层优势以及IP地址定位策略,使得网络设置灵活可靠,同时也方便维护更新设备软件版本。

综上所述,在考虑到工程经济性质,我们发现尽管某些情况下可以使用较低成本但功能有限的小型微处理单元,但是在面临复杂环境下的高度精确性的情况下,则必须依赖更强大的中央计算平台——即这就是为什么人们倾向于根据具体业务需求选择合适工具的问题。然而,即使在面对巨大挑战的时候,只要我们能够正确地理解并利用每种工具带来的好处,那么无论是在生产力提升还是成本节约上,都能达到最佳效果。如果你正在寻找如何有效地将这些工具融入你的项目之中,本文旨在提供一个全面的参考框架供您作为决策依据之一步棋迈向成功之路。

上一篇:嵌入式系统概述与应用场景
下一篇:工业工控机的秘密生活它们是如何在夜晚变身为小提琴手的